520 _aIn this highly respected work, Harold Crouch analyzes the role of the Indonesian army in that country's politics, putting special emphasis on the Sukarno years, the gradual take-over of power by the military, and the nature of Suharto's New Order government. The Army and Politics in Indonesia is now available in a paperback edition, updated with a new preface and epilogue that expand the book's coverage to the 1980s.
